Molecular mechanics for the calculations of metallocarborane molecules

Molecular mechanics force field for metallocarboranes was developed. Conformational calculations of metallocene sandwich complexes analogs [RR'C2B4H4]2M, R and R'=Me3Si or Me, M = Si, Ge, Sn, Pb were undertaken. The calculation showed that short metal-ligand distances (M = Si, Ge) correspond to parallel-sandwich conformations whereas bent-sandwich complexes are characterized by longer distances (M = Sn, Pb). 24 refs.; 3 figs.; 4 tabs
